11. Particip<strong>at</strong>ion <strong>of</strong> Traditional<br />
Communities, Authorities<br />
and Organiz<strong>at</strong>ions<br />
Stakeholders took part in the resettlement by identifying<br />
and acquiring land, designing houses and urban<br />
development schemes, and preserving the archeological<br />
heritage, as described below.<br />
Land<br />
The Reconstruction Commission established a Land<br />
Procurement Commission to find land suitable for the<br />
resettlement. It consisted <strong>of</strong> represent<strong>at</strong>ives from the<br />
community and the Secretari<strong>at</strong> <strong>of</strong> Agrarian Affairs.<br />
Designing houses and urban development<br />
The Reconstruction Commission also established the<br />
Urban Design and Housing Design Commissions,<br />
comprised <strong>of</strong> four members from the community and<br />
some from the Guillermo Toriello Found<strong>at</strong>ion, the<br />
Executive Secretari<strong>at</strong> <strong>of</strong> the Presidency (SCEP), the<br />
N<strong>at</strong>ional Reconstruction Manager, the N<strong>at</strong>ional Housing<br />
Fund (FOGUAVI) and the UN Human Settlements<br />
Programme.<br />
The urban and housing design proposals were based on<br />
a study <strong>of</strong> customs and traditions by the University <strong>of</strong><br />
San Carlos de Gu<strong>at</strong>emala (Universidad de San Carlos<br />
de Gu<strong>at</strong>emala, USAC), which influenced the layout <strong>of</strong><br />
streets, demarc<strong>at</strong>ion <strong>of</strong> lots assigned for houses, and the<br />
design <strong>of</strong> houses. The community was actively involved<br />
in the housing design process. However, because people<br />
were not familiar with technical drawings and scale<br />
models to perceive spaces and dimensions, it was necessary<br />
to conduct an exercise in which the community<br />
itself formed human chains to give an idea <strong>of</strong> the size<br />
and shape <strong>of</strong> a house and <strong>of</strong> the rooms inside it. Th<strong>at</strong><br />
process produced consensus, after which a model house<br />
was designed th<strong>at</strong> could be used in subsequent phases <strong>of</strong><br />
the resettlement.<br />
Preserving the archeological heritage<br />
A Ministry <strong>of</strong> Culture archeologist trained local leaders<br />
about archeological remains th<strong>at</strong> might be found on the<br />
lots earmarked for resettlement. In turn, the leaders supervised<br />
the construction teams so as to identify archeological<br />
remains. When some were found, the commission<br />
was informed and the land demarc<strong>at</strong>ion was realigned.<br />
For example, during construction, the remains <strong>of</strong> a Mayan<br />
dwelling were discovered– the only one <strong>of</strong> its kind in<br />
the country—which has since become a tourist <strong>at</strong>traction.<br />
